ᴘʀɪɴᴄᴇss ʀᴇᴠɪᴇᴡs: 3
Bones And All(2022)
6.5/10⭐️
*spoilers, ahead!!*
*TW:Gore, body horror, sex and cannibalism
-
-
-
-
Bones and All is a very complicated movie for me personally, I really wanted to like this more than I actually did. This movie got a lot right, but for me it wasn’t quite there. To summarize this movie it’s about people who are called “eaters “, and essentially their cannibals, but they’re born with it. Now to get this out of the way, I have not read the book and this review is only on the movie. I really enjoyed the concept of this in the originality of it, we often do see cannibals and horror, but nothing really like this. Marren has a main protagonist isn’t bad but I feel we don’t see her full potential. Obviously, she has a lot going on. She has to battle with being hungry, but feeling the guilt of eating people, which is something I heavily enjoyed about the movie, the questions it asked, but she just feels a little flat. Lee is fine, Timothée Chalamet’s performance is nothing out of the ordinary for him, but it’s decent enough. my main complaint about the movie in my opinion is that I never felt chemistry between the two of them, which is something I would’ve expected with a movie covering a topic like this,for anyone who’s unaware of this movie is an allegory for queer love, but you could also just take it as love in general. I never thought they really got to know each other or bond on a deeper level, maybe it’s just the pacing, but I wasn’t really a fan of them. Now to get into what I enjoyed, the cinematography of this movie is beautiful, the aesthetic is beautiful, and I really did enjoy the gore and effects. The ending was perfectly fine, dark and desolate which I really liked out of a film like this, I saw others saying not so much but me personally I did enjoy it, overall I think this film is good, I definitely will check out the book at some point, if I were you I would check this out and that’s my review!

ᴘʀɪɴᴄᴇss ʀᴇᴠɪᴇᴡs: 2
Opus(2025)
3.5/10 ⭐️
*spoilers ahead!!*
*TW: Gore, body horror, talk of cults
-
-
-
-
As a long time horror fan I think I’m tired of this genre of movie. To summarize this movie it’s essentially about a famous popstar who decides to release an album for the first time in 30 years, and invites a group of people to visit him for a weekend, but not everything is as it seems. I’ve seen a lot of movies do this trope before such as Midsommar, Don’t Worry, Darling, Get Out, Blink Twice and The Menu, all these movies follow a plot of stuff not being as it seems, and also political commentary, and all these movies do it much better in my opinion. This movie is perfect perfectly fine on its own. I would say it’s just a bit boring at times I felt it was very slow. The main character is perfectly average, nothing new or extraordinary. Though I will say the practical effects were very good and there’s one scene with slight body horror, which I thought was pretty good.(you’ll know the one.) Cults are something I think can be used uniquely in horror, but most cult horror movies are similar nowadays, the end was meh. The acting is perfectly fine, nothing horrible nothing spectacular. I am happy. We are getting new movies especially new horror, but this one just didn’t really hit for me. overall, I would say support new horror, movies or new movies in general but I really wouldn’t watch this. There’s better movies with similar plots out there, like the ones I mentioned.

ᴘʀɪɴᴄᴇss ʀᴇᴠɪᴇᴡs: 1
Megan is Missing(2011)
1/10 ⭐️
*spoilers, but I wouldn’t recommend watching this tbh
*TW: mentions of rape, sexual assault of minors, torture, gore and a shitty movie
-
-
-
-
when I stepped into this movie, I expected something disturbing from the way TikTok and Instagram described it. This movie is completely child porn in my opinion or at least fails to get its message across. This movie is supposed to be about two young 14 year-old girls who mess around, party, and talk to older guys. I have never met a 14-year-old girl who behaves like the two main characters in this movie. Call me a prude, but I think this movie is grossly over sexualizing young girls, and could’ve went without it to still try to get its message across, so what is its message? This is supposed to be based on a true story, that’s what it says at the beginning, but it’s not at the end you can see in the credits. It says all events in this movie are fictitious. To summarize the movie quickly as the title suggest Megan does go missing, she gets kidnapped by an older guy, and her friend goes to find her. I think the acting in this movie is mediocre. There are some moments where I was impressed but all the material that’s supposed to be ‘ disturbing’, really isn’t. I’m someone who enjoys body horror and gore, but this movie has a little of that though I’m not saying you need that to make a horror movie or thriller disturbing but those are aspects that can make it disturbing. I think the most disturbing thing about this is the fact that there’s so many graphic rape scenes. Which again these are supposed to be 14 year-old girls, I’m not saying something like this couldn’t happen in real life and I understand that’s what the movie is trying to get at. But was it really necessary to show the graphic rape scenes? This movie honestly could’ve worked. I really do like true crime esc movies, and it could be a good warning to young girls who were on the Internet, but this movie feels so fake and like it’s trying to be scary and freak you out, but misses the memo. Everyone always talks about the barrel scene and the photos but honestly, it wasn’t anything too bad, I think the main shock again came from the fact that these girls were only 14 which in my opinion isn’t a good way to disturb viewers.
Overall, I really would not recommend this movie, I really watched it just to say that I have and see if it really was the as scary as people said it was and obviously no it was not.
